Introduction to IPv6 Socket Programming
Owen DeLong
IPv6 Evangelist, Hurrican Electric
Linux Users' Group of Davis
February 21, 2011
"Porting IPv6 applications to IPv4/v6 dual stack
(624KB PDF)
presentation slides (624KB PDF)
Example code:
Specifications
(TXT)
usage of server & client apps)
C
v4_server.c
v6_server.c
diff_server
v4_client.c
v6_client.c
diff_client
fixes.h
(
strnlen
)
Perl
v4_server.pl
v6_server.pl
diff_server
v4_client.pl
v6_client.pl
diff_client
Python
v4_server.py
v6_server.py
diff_server
v4_client.py
v6_client.py
diff_client
Other Links:
Feb. 21st, 2011 LUGOD meeting:
Meeting minutes
Photos
"IPv6 Porting Information"
(source of slides and example code mirrored here, plus more)
Hurrican Electric home page
Linux Users' Group of Davis home page